12th July 2005

Chris Batty (England), Hugo Romano, Tânia Pestana and Catarina Fagundes (Madeira Wind Birds)

What a night! At Pico do Areeiro we were above a fluffy sea of clouds and under billions of stars, with less than half moon and no breeze.
Since 11pm we heard several calls from different Zino's Petrels at different sites. Some silhouttes were seen, one so close that we could almost touch it. One bird has flewed so near that we perfectly heard the flap of its wings.
